Preparations underway for 2018 Empty Bowls event
The Empty Bowls dinner takes place at St. John’s Catholic Church in Grand Marais on Thursday, November 15.
In preparation for the event, The Grand Marais Art Colony has been hosting Make-A-Bowl sessions over the past weeks to provide bowls for the dinner. A session on Saturday, November 10 included members of the Cook County High School Student Council. Student Council member Malin Anderson said Empty Bowls is a great opportunity for the Student Council to volunteer in the community.
